Why Study Gender & Society?
- Studying Gender & Society helps reveal and analyze disparities in power, opportunity, and resources between genders, contributing to efforts to address and reduce inequality.
- It challenges and changes unfair ideas about what men and women should and should not do, addressing stereotypes.
- It helps create fairer rules and policies by understanding gender issues, ensuring everyone gets a fair chance, leading to better policies.
- It helps to make society more just and equal; shows how gender interacts with fairness for all.
- It helps people understand their own and others' gender roles better, leading to understanding each other and better relationships.
- It encourages people to push for changes that make life better and fairer for everyone leading to making a difference.

Situation of Women Worldwide
- In 2019, 47% of women of working age joined the labor market.
- In 2019, 28% of managerial positions globally were occupied by women.
- In 2022, 18% of enterprises had female CEOs.
- In 2020, 25% of parliament seats were occupied by women.
- In 2020, 22% of Cabinet positions were occupied by women.
- 1/3 of women worldwide experienced physical and/or sexual violence.
- Everyday 137 women are killed by their intimate partner or a family member.
- Laws on domestic violence are not yet universally available, with only 153 countries having such laws.
- One in four married Filipino women aged 15 to 49 experience physical, sexual, and emotional violence from their current partner.
- Gender-based online sexual harassment continues to rise.
Legal Basis
- CHED Memorandum Order No. 01, Series of 2015.
- Convention on the Elimination of All Forms of Discrimination Against Women (CEDAW).
- 1987 Constitution, Article II, Section 14 recognizes the role of women in nation-building and ensures fundamental equality.
- Republic Act No. 9710 - Magna Carta for Women.
- Beijing Platform for Action (BFPA).
